Much like how the H-6K looks similar from the outside to the Tu-16 and yet is completely different on the inside, so is this helicopter.
This is a helicopter built with XXIst century technology based on the Blackhawk's airframe. Internally it shares little. The engines aren't the same, and it has fly by wire. It uses composite blades with more area and higher powered engines to operate better at high altitude.
